Hi All

I am getting error "No response from the backend" while connecting to my
postgres database.

pg_log file logs the below messages :

GMT FATAL: semop(id=1310723) failed: Invalid argument

GMT FATAL: semop(id=1310723) failed: Invalid argument

GMT FATAL: semctl(1310723, 7, SETVAL, 0) failed: Invalid argument

GMT FATAL: semctl(1310723, 12, SETVAL, 0) failed: Invalid argument

GMT LOG: server process (PID 10776) exited with exit code 1

GMT LOG: terminating any other active server processes

GMT WARNING: terminating connection because of crash of another server
process

GMT DETAIL: The postmaster has commanded this server process to roll
back the current transaction and exit, because another server proc

ess exited abnormally and possibly corrupted shared memory.

GMT HINT: In a moment you should be able to reconnect to the database
and repeat your command.

The above message is printed a number of times and after that it prints

GMT LOG: all server processes terminated; reinitializing

GMT LOG: semctl(1245185, 0, IPC_RMID, ...) failed: Invalid argument

GMT LOG: semctl(1277954, 0, IPC_RMID, ...) failed: Invalid argument

GMT LOG: semctl(1310723, 0, IPC_RMID, ...) failed: Invalid argument

GMT LOG: semctl(1343492, 0, IPC_RMID, ...) failed: Invalid argument

GMT LOG: shmctl(2097152, 0, 0) failed: Invalid argument

GMT LOG: database system was interrupted at 2009-09-15 07:28:40 GMT

GMT LOG: checkpoint record is at A/2311BA94

GMT LOG: redo record is at A/23106A14; undo record is at 0/0; shutdown
FALSE

GMT LOG: next transaction ID: 20175128; next OID: 58650

GMT LOG: next MultiXactId: 1; next MultiXactOffset: 0

GMT LOG: database system was not properly shut down; automatic recovery
in progress

GMT LOG: redo starts at A/23106A14

GMT LOG: record with zero length at A/2317BF50

GMT LOG: redo done at A/2317BF28

GMT FATAL: the database system is starting up

GMT LOG: database system is ready

The postgresql log file doesn't print anything about restarting
postgres. I couldn't get any information from other logs regarding which
process was killed, who killed it and why.

Please help.
